Where an Indian engineer can actually get a startup job abroad in 2026: twelve hubs compared on visas, pay after tax and rent, and remote-from-India hiring
For candidates in India weighing a move or a remote role: the world's main startup cities compared on how hard the visa is from India, what a senior salary is worth after tax and rent against Bengaluru, time-zone overlap with IST, dominant sectors, and how common remote-from-India hiring is — with links to the full guide for each city.

If you're in Bengaluru, Hyderabad or Pune and wondering where a startup job abroad is genuinely reachable — and whether it's worth it against what you'd earn at home — this is the comparison. Two tables: one on reachability from India, one on money. Pay levels are for a senior engineer at a funded startup, as of writing, and rough; the city guides have ranges and each has a section written for candidates applying from India.
Reachability from India
| City | Visa route from India | How hard | Remote-from-India hiring | IST overlap |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Dubai / Abu Dhabi | Employer visa, weeks; Golden Visa above a threshold | Easiest | Very common (the other way round too) | Near-total |
| Singapore | Employment Pass + COMPASS | Moderate; hard for junior | Very common | Near-total |
| Toronto | Global Talent Stream; Express Entry for PR | Easy, and leads to PR | Common | Evening IST |
| Berlin | EU Blue Card | Easy | Common | Afternoon IST |
| Amsterdam | Highly skilled migrant | Easy | Common | Afternoon IST |
| Stockholm | Certified-employer work permit | Easy | Common | Afternoon IST |
| London | Skilled Worker (threshold rose 2024); Young Professionals ballot under 30 | Moderate | Very common | Afternoon IST — best of the West |
| Paris | French Tech Visa | Moderate; French needed outside AI | Less common | Afternoon IST |
| Sydney | Skills in Demand; slow | Moderate | Common | Late-morning IST |
| Lisbon | D3 / Tech Visa / D8 nomad | Slow | Rare for local startups | Afternoon IST |
| SF, NYC, Seattle, Austin, Boston, LA | H-1B lottery, O-1, US degree + OPT | Hard | Very common | Late night IST (NYC/Boston best) |
| Tel Aviv | Rare; local hiring | Hard | Common at Series B+ | Afternoon IST |
| São Paulo | Slow; Portuguese needed | Hard | Rare | Night IST |
Pay, cost and sectors
| City | Pay level | Rent (1-bed, central) | Visa difficulty for a hire | Dominant sectors | Remote norm |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| San Francisco | Highest | Very high | Hard (H-1B lottery; O-1 for some) | AI, dev tools, deep tech | In-office 3–5 days |
| New York | Very high | Very high | Hard (same as SF) | Fintech, health, media | Hybrid 3 days |
| London | High for Europe | Very high | Moderate (Skilled Worker; thresholds rose) | Fintech, AI, climate | Hybrid 2–3 days |
| Berlin | Mid-high | Moderate | Easy (EU Blue Card) | B2B SaaS, fintech, climate | Remote-friendly |
| Paris | Mid | High | Moderate (French Tech Visa) | AI, fintech, health | Hybrid |
| Amsterdam | Mid-high | High | Easy (highly skilled migrant) | Fintech, travel, SaaS | Hybrid |
| Bengaluru | Local-high | Low–moderate | N/A for most readers; easy for Indians | Fintech, SaaS, consumer | Hybrid; remote common |
| Singapore | High | Very high | Moderate (EP thresholds + COMPASS) | Fintech, regional HQ roles | In-office 3+ days |
| Dubai | High net (no tax) | High | Easy (employer visa) | Fintech, logistics, commercial roles | In-office |
| Toronto | Mid-high | High | Easiest (Global Talent Stream) | Fintech, AI, health | Hybrid; remote-for-US common |
| São Paulo | Local-high | Moderate | Moderate; Portuguese needed | Fintech, marketplaces | Hybrid; remote in Brazil |
| Tel Aviv | Very high | Very high | Hard; mostly local hiring | Cybersecurity, infrastructure | In-office |
| Sydney | High | Very high | Moderate (Skills in Demand) | Fintech, SaaS, climate | Hybrid |
How to read it
Pay level is meaningless without rent and tax — and without the comparison to staying. A strong Bengaluru senior engineer earns ₹60 L–₹1 Cr; after tax and a ₹40k–₹60k rent that is a comfortable life with a high savings rate. Against that, London and Berlin come out roughly level net-after-rent, Toronto and Sydney modestly ahead, Singapore and Seattle clearly ahead, and Dubai furthest ahead because nothing is taxed. San Francisco pays double Berlin and costs triple. Convert every offer to a monthly after-tax figure in the city you'd live in — here's the method — and compare it to your Bengaluru number, not to zero.
Visa difficulty is from the perspective of a startup under fifty people deciding whether to hire you, from India. The Gulf is easiest; Canada, Germany, the Netherlands and Sweden are easy because the process is defined and cheap and they've each processed tens of thousands of Indian applicants; the UK and Singapore sit in between with salary thresholds that rule out junior roles; the US is hard because H-1B is a lottery and small companies rarely enter it — for most people the US route runs through a US degree or a large employer first. Tel Aviv and São Paulo hire locally almost by default.
Dominant sectors tell you where the depth is. If you're a security engineer, Tel Aviv has more relevant companies than the rest of the list combined; if you're in fintech, New York, London and São Paulo; if you want AI research adjacency, San Francisco, Paris, London and Toronto.
Remote norm shifted after 2023, and mostly towards the office in the US and Asia, less so in Europe. Toronto and Berlin are the cities from which working remotely for a company elsewhere is most common.
Three ways to choose
- Follow the visa. From India, start with Dubai, Toronto, Berlin, Amsterdam and Singapore; then London and Sydney; treat the US as a move you make via a degree or a large employer, or later in your career with an O-1-worthy record.
- Follow the sector. Security → Tel Aviv (remotely) or London; AI research → Paris, London, Toronto, and the US if you can get there; fintech → London, Singapore, New York; consumer → the US West Coast, remotely.
- Stay in India, take the remote job. For many people the best option is a remote role for a London, Berlin, Singapore or US company on their India band — typically ₹50 L–₹1.5 Cr for senior engineers, paid into India, with your family, your cost base and no visa.
